Ability to design SQL databases given applications demands and data models Working knowledge and experience of application servers, ideally WebLogic and AWS Proven ability to write well-designed, efficient, and testable code Experience supporting a test-driven development culture Knowledge and experience working with information and security architectures Experience programming in Agile methodologies ## Description The Massachusetts Executive O?ce of Health and Human Services (EOHHS) is seeking to hire a motivated IT Senior AWS Developer to join its Medicaid Systems Development (MSD) team supporting MassHealth Applications. MassHealth (MH) is the EOHHS o?ce that administers the Medicaid program and the Children's Health Insurance Program (CHIP) in Massachusetts. MassHealth applications provide critical support for access to health care for some of Massachusetts' most vulnerable individuals. The Sr. AWS developer's primary role is to support OLTSS initiative to design and develop a serverless application that enables providers to submit an online CIR form and seamlessly transmit the files to our document management system (EDM). The solution captures and stores metadata during upload sessions in a PostgreSQL RDS database for audit and compliance purposes. MassHealth is looking for motivated individuals with deep technical expertise in AWS that seek-out public service as an opportunity, gain valuable experience, and give back to the community. This position is anticipated to be a minimum six-month engagement with the possibility of being extended for a longer term.
